Long Live Rock ‘n’ Roll by Rainbow
About the album Long Live Rock ‘n’ Roll
Long Live Rock 'n' Roll was the third album by Rainbow, but it also marked the end of an era for the band, as it was the last album where we hear Ronnie James Dio on vocals.
The sound of Long Live Rock 'n' Roll was clearly a hard rock sound, and Martin Birch played his role in the production.
It did not become a huge commercial success, but along with the two previous Rainbow albums, it forms a very strong and tight trio of excellent hard rock albums in the second half of the 1970s.
